Job Description: Details of the Division and Team: Loan Ops is responsible for managing the end-to-end Loan settlement process. This is to ensure smooth and timely market settlement of loan between the bank and its clients. Work includes: - Supporting interaction between internal and external stakeholders involved in the loan process chain - Collect the loan documents from clients and perform the system booking for loan payments - Ensuring adherence to market standards What we will offer you: A healthy, engaged and well-supported workforce is better equipped to do their best work and, more importantly, enjoy their lives inside and outside the workplace. Job Description: Job Title CLO & Private Credit Services – Account Manager Corporate Title NCT- Vice President Location Santa Ana, CA or New York, NY (ALL ROLES TO BE CONSIDERED) Overview CLO & Private Credit Services was started back in 2000.  Our staff of professionals provides trustee, calculation agent, collateral administration, and custodian services on over 400 SPVs both domestically and throughout Europe. The Account Manager is the primary point of contact for our clients, the collateral managers of Collateralized Loan Obligations.  You must have a deep understanding CLOs, ABLs, compliance test calculations, bank loans and other complex fixed income structures. You will provide oversight of day to day operational/client service activities while monitoring controls such as overdraft reports, annual reviews, and outstanding deal compliance. What You’ll Do Primary point of contact for a portfolio of CLO Special Purpose Vehicles. Produce monthly /quarterly investor reporting packages.  Must have intimate knowledge of all test calculations in the issued reports. Review and release wires for trade settlements. Communicate with arrangers, collateral managers, rating agencies, accountants and bondholders. Close interaction with DB Operations and Account Administrators. Maintain each SPV's annual compliance requirements (Accountant's Reports, Issuer's Certifications, etc.). How You’ll Lead Senior Management – Must be able to succinctly communicate with high level leaders within the organization Clients – Must understand the CLO transaction and be able to interact with Collateral Managers and Investors on the internal mechanics of a deal Analytics/IT – Must be able to identify operational bottleneck and work together with IT/Analytics to develop and implement a solution Skills You’ll Need BA/BS, preferably in Accounting, Finance, Business or Economics, MBA a plus Minimum 3 to 5 years prior experience with CLOs Understanding of bank loans Understanding of general accounting and financial reporting principles General understanding of structured credit products Skills That Will Help You Excel Understanding of BSL, middle market and private credit loans. Understanding of ABLs and borrowing base calculations, a plus. Competent in all MS Office products. Familiarity with wiring instructions, SWIFT payments a plus. Experience reviewing indentures, credit agreements and other governing documents. Advanced MS Excel abilities - Comfortable with complex formulas and modelling techniques.
